Ordering number : ENA1991
LV5099CB
Bi-CMOS LSI
For HDMI controller
Charge pump power supply
Overview
The LV5099CB is a charge pump power supply for HDMI controllers for portable devices.
Features and Functions
Features
5.0V and 3.3V constant voltage outputs composed of 2-hold mode charge pump boost circuit.
Built-in overload detection function for constant voltage output circuit.
Overcurrent limit (70mA) operates with 1.5external resistor.
Constant voltage output after time-latch: OFF (100msec).
Reverse flow prevention function is built into constant voltage output.
(An external diode for reverse flow prevention is not necessary.)
There is no reverse current from 5.0V output to VCC.
The current flow into 3.3V output is less than 1µA, when EN: Low
Ultra-small chip package (Those with backcourt processing (those with a resin tabulation side protective film))
Function
Charge pump circuit. 2-hold mode
Constant voltage output. 3.3V output/10mA(max) 5.0V output/60mA(max)
Thermal shutdown
